Official Journal of the European Union

C 349/7

(Case C-848/19 P) (<span class="oj-super oj-note-tag">1</span>)

(Appeal - Article 194(1) TFEU - Principle of energy solidarity - Directive 2009/73/EC - Internal market in natural gas - Article 36(1) - Decision of the European Commission on review of the exemption of the OPAL pipeline from the requirements on third-party access and tariff regulation following a request by the German regulatory authority - Action for annulment)

(2021/C 349/08)

Language of the case: Polish

Parties

Appellant: Federal Republic of Germany (represented by: J. Möller and D. Klebs, acting as Agents, and by H. Haller, T. Heitling, L. Reiser and V. Vacha, Rechtsanwälte)

Other parties to the proceedings: Republic of Poland (represented by: B. Majczyna, M. Kawnik and M. Nowacki, acting as Agents), European Commission (represented by: O. Beynet and K. Herrmann, acting as Agents), Republic of Latvia (represented: initially by K. Pommere, V. Soņeca and E. Bārdiņš, and subsequently by K. Pommere, V. Kalniņa and E. Bārdiņš, acting as Agents), Republic of Lithuania (represented by: R. Dzikovič and K. Dieninis, acting as Agents)

Operative part of the judgment

The Court:

1.Dismisses the appeal;

2.Orders the Federal Republic of Germany to bear its own costs and to pay those incurred by the Republic of Poland;

3.Orders the Republic of Latvia, the Republic of Lithuania and the European Commission to bear their own costs.
